I was all about Ramsey leading to the draft. Cowboys needed a shutdown corner or a huge playmaking corner, and he was being hyped as the best corner to come out in awhile. A couple weeks before the draft though, it started coming out that some GMs didn't see him as a corner, that he was more of a safety. That worried me, and after looking back at his tape, I sadly agreed. He was getting beat by quick route running routinely, he just didn't have the feet/hips to keep up with those kind of plays. He is still a great player, he reminds me a lot of Malcolm Jenkins, the safety for the Eagles. He started at corner for his first couple of years, but they switched him to safety when they realized he was more of a playmaker from that slot. I think Dallas would have drafted a true top 5 caliber corner or defensive end over Zeke, but there wasn't one in the draft.
